How to upload the apk? GoFit covers anything fitness, wellness, gym and health-related. this work for me. Site design / logo 2022 Stack Exchange Inc; user contributions licensed under CC BY-SA. example, using the https://bit.ly site. Even if I accept it and install it, on the next install it logs "Installation blocked silently" and I get an "App not installed" message on the UI. Also are you sure that the init got completed without any issues? If you are in the process of building a mobile app for iOS or Android, do yourself a favor and quick-start your project with these React Native templates. In Android Studio click in Tools -> SDK Manager -> in System Settings click in Android SDK -> choose tab SDK Tools, then enable Android SDK command line tools (lasted). React Native Starter equips you with a starter kit for swift mobile app realization. i-e: Step : 3 -> Remove "rnpm" object from "package.json". If you are using Genymotion go to Settings -> ADB, select Use custom Android SDK tools, and point it at your Android SDK directory.. All rights reserved. What caused this for me was running npm install --save [package] when actually the system has previously been using yarn instead of npm. To avoid that, create a react-native.config.js file at the root of your react-native project with: Before you can run the project, follow the Getting Started Guide for Facebook Android SDK to set up a Facebook app. Why don't we know exactly where the Chinese rocket will fall? So I replaced an android.jks on my hard drive with the one from the cloud, created a signed apk and the problem has gone. These operations are Create either an iOS or an Android app in pretty much no time. BeoNews is here to make an immediate difference and take your online project to new heights. The problem was that I terminated init command because it looked like hanged without errors (even 24 hours later). With the different demo layouts and other skins, you can quickly set things up and start your thing sooner rather than later. lol good to see number of upvotes and know I'm not alone xD thanks! Seven modules and over one hundred screens await every user out of the box. Plus other answers already cover a simple implementation. Preferably enter the address of America with the code 01, It is probably sensitive to Persian, so it is better not to write in Persian in the program. then run follow these steps it will definitely help you. why is there always an auto-save file in the directory where the file I am editing? Quick and efficient way to create graphs from a list of list, Fourier transform of a functional derivative, Having kids in grad school while both parents do PhDs. The default web design is also clean and simple, ensuring a better mobile experience. Ionic is an open source app development toolkit for building modern, fast, top-quality cross-platform native and Progressive Web Apps from a single codebase with JavaScript and the Web. How do I completely uninstall Node.js, and reinstall from beginning (Mac OS X), Can't start Eclipse - Java was started but returned exit code=13. stackoverflow.com/posts/30540502/revisions, https://www.npmjs.com/package/react-native-hyperlink, github.com/naoufal/react-native-safari-view, Making location easier for developers with new data primitives, Stop requiring only one assertion per unit test: Multiple assertions are fine, Mobile app infrastructure being decommissioned. What is the effect of cycling on weight loss? The JavaScript API is simple and cross-platform - just install it in your app and give your users the native feel they deserve. Update: Note that if you're using a http connection with server ,you should use SSL. Follow the installation guides in the documentation. Even though it might cost you nothing, Now UI still rocks loads of material for your convenience. Is there anything I could be doing wrong and are you sure this workaround works right now? Site design / logo 2022 Stack Exchange Inc; user contributions licensed under CC BY-SA. Hence the name, GoFit must have something to do with fitness and health. I am banging my head into the walls at this point. React Native Navigation React Native Navigation provides 100% native platform navigation on both iOS and Android for React Native apps. The last pre-0.63 compatible version is v5.1.3. 4.2 Add Required Capabilities. I found the instructions to do with Expo emulators a little lacking in detail. The Run iOS command similarly triggers react-native run-ios and starts your app in the iOS simulator (e.g. It will install the missing files in node_modules. In Signing & Capabilities, select All and + Capability.Add "Push Notifications". A complete native navigation solution for React Native. The Run iOS command similarly triggers react-native run-ios and starts your app in the iOS simulator (e.g. Error Running React Native App From Terminal (iOS), React Native Error: ENOSPC: System limit for number of file watchers reached. Pick a path to store our key file and fill the required details like Nam, Password, City, etc and click OK. 14. Lets Build Together. Whether you are learning to work with RN, plan to create a few prototypes, or even go with final app creation, let React Native Starter Kit get you going like a champ. How many characters/pages could WordStar hold on a typical CP/M machine? Google is providing safety device verification api which you need to call only once in your application and after that your application will not be blocked by play protect: https://developer.android.com/training/safetynet/attestation#verify-attestation-response, https://github.com/googlesamples/android-play-safetynet, the only solution worked for me was using java keytool and generating a .keystore file the command line and then use that .keystore file to sign my app, you can find the java keytool at this directory C:\Program Files\Java\jre7\bin, open a command window and switch to that directory and enter a command like this. Hello. Spanish - How to write lm instead of lim? react_native run_android Signed with suspended apk keystore and tried to install. In Signing & Capabilities, select All and + Capability.Add "Push Notifications". This versions supports react-native@0.63+. The keystore contains a single key, valid for 10000 days. Yes, there are alternatives to React Native like ionic and flutter but ionic is used to create a hybrid application that doesnt give us native-like experience. It's working for our purposes as such: How to Open URL "on click" after Scanning a QR Code in React-Native Android App. @SaddaHussain it still works you must be doing something wrong make sure that you're not calling the api with a different package and then changing your app signature later the api needs to be called only once from your main activity and after that your app will not be blocked anymore. Update: The following method doesn't work anymore. After installing chocolatey run the below command to install node, python, and java. Indeed, in the kit, Felix Travel delivers all the elements and reusable components for quick mobile app creation. In the collection of features, you will find tons of practical stuff for building a mobile app exactly to your liking. "generate signed Bundle" Try adding these useful tips to have a user-friendly React Native mobile app design. if there is a downvote i like to know why. Asking for help, clarification, or responding to other answers. Network Security Friendly support and frequent updates are also part of the deal. On Android and iOS, it'll use React Native's Linking module to handle incoming links, both when the app was opened with the link, and when new links are received when the app is open. 1. Just run this command. At first I created application with com.foo.xyz even if you create a new app has the problem out of the box. Ready to get started? Apps developed using Apache Cordova, Flutter, Xamarin, React Native, Sencha Touch, and other frameworks fall into this category. Lets look at some of the best options that cover different niches and industries out of the box. I am uninstalling the app and reinstalling the same apk and still getting play protect warning. Its not a particularly obvious message and youd be surprised how easy it is to forget both steps. More info / Download Demo React Native Starter Kit 70 Best Free Responsive Website Templates For Better Mobile User Experience. You did not install the contents of the project. Actually, should it take so long? if you didn't succeed, use another Gmail in Android Studio and generate new keystore. To avoid that, create a react-native.config.js file at the root of your react-native project with: It is a convenient solution that boosts your websites mobile performance. Find centralized, trusted content and collaborate around the technologies you use most. Navigate to build menu in Android Studio and click on Generate signed bundle / APK . Select the root project and main app target. Is cycling an aerobic or anaerobic exercise? If the example app is already running, close it before testing. In your XCode Settings, in the Build Phases tab, under Copy Bundle Resources add the fonts you have copied in the Fonts directory.. An emulator is a virtual device that lets you test your app without owning an actual device. The folder by default for my PC was under C:\Windows\system32\AwesomeProject in Windows. Select the root project and main app target. Make sure your passwords are different in By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. 4.1 Run cd ios && pod install. Please feel free to tweak it to your needs. 2. if i'm doing something wrong i like to know, It didn't solve my issue unfortunately, I guess there are several use-cases leading to the same issue, https://developer.android.com/distribute/best-practices/develop/understand-play-policies, http://docs.oracle.com/javase/6/docs/technotes/tools/windows/keytool.html, http://developer.android.com/tools/publishing/app-signing.html, https://support.google.com/googleplay/android-developer/answer/2992033?hl=en, Making location easier for developers with new data primitives, Stop requiring only one assertion per unit test: Multiple assertions are fine, Mobile app infrastructure being decommissioned. initializes the package.json. here is a reference: the solution lies in creating a new key when generating the signed apk. The Activity class provides a number of callbacks that allow the activity to know that a state has changed: that the system is creating, stopping, or resuming an activity, or destroying the process in which the activity resides. The keystore and key are protected by the passwords you entered. In this case simply reinstall your libraries globally. Disable autolinking for React Native 0.60 and above: Inside the node_modules folder in each App Center package open react-native.config.js and set dependency.platforms.ios to null:; module.exports = { dependency: { platforms: { ios: null, } } }; Modify Header Search Paths to find React Native headers from the App Center React Native plugins projects: Creating a Flutter project builds all the files that you need to run a sample app on both Android and iOS devices.. How do I run my app? Just make sure while running the command react-native run-android that, you are inside the AwesomeProject folder created by the react-native init AwesomeProject command.. Check out the docs. At that point, only disabling Play Protect altogether or clearing Play Store data from settings gets me the popup again. React-native-app-auth can support PKCE only if your Identity Provider supports it. Couldnt start project on Android: No Android connected device found, and no emulators could be started automatically. 3. Making a mobile app all of a sudden becomes much more straightforward than you previously thought. 4. Ensure you run the command in the projects' terminal, preferably the Android IDE. Required fields are marked *. Open the terminal in the directory where you want to set up your react native project and run below command. If you have deleted nodemodules try "npm install". Over 260 screens, more than sixteen UI/UX, RTL compatibility, practical navigability, music-ready screens, you get the gist of it. Please feel free to tweak it to your needs. Take a look at: https://developer.android.com/distribute/best-practices/develop/understand-play-policies. Click + Capability to add Background Modes and check Remote notifications.. 4.3 Add a Notification Service I also faced same issue with my app. 3. You need to disable Play Protect in Play Store -> Play Protect -> Settings Icon -> Scan Device for security threats, Use special trackers in your app (firebase and appmetrica are tested and are ok), choose either Bundle / APK (in my case APK) and click Next, click on create new (make sure you have a keystore path on the machine), after everything, click finish to generate your signed apk. I never have a google play console account. The Run Android command triggers react-native run-android and starts your app for Android. Step : 4 -> Replace your "scripts" with below mentioned "scripts" inside "package.json". You can embed
Reduction Sauce Examples,
Is 200mg Of Caffeine A Lot For Pre Workout,
Temperley - Atletico Gimnasia Y Esgrima De Mendoza Prediction,
Kendo Grid Format Date,
Dollface Stella And Liv Break Up,
Bora-care Mixing Ratio,
Savannah Airport Commission Bids,
How Many Calories Are In 9 Bagel Bites,